### Potential Benefits of Short-Selling PLTR
The high valuation of Palantir's stock, with premium multiples relative to sales, implies that if the company fails to meet growth expectations or if market sentiment turns bearish, the stock could experience sharp declines, offering profit opportunities for short sellers. Additionally, Palantir's substantial stock-based compensation can lead to an increase in shares outstanding, which may erode shareholder value and put downward pressure on the stock price over time.
### Risks of Short-Selling PLTR
Despite these potential benefits, short-selling Palantir carries risks. The company has demonstrated strong revenue growth and bullish technical momentum, with its stock trading above key moving averages and showing positive medium-term trends. Palantir's strategic position in AI, defense, and big data analytics gives it a significant total addressable market (TAM), leading some to believe that the company could grow comparably to tech giants like Microsoft, suggesting substantial future upside.
Moreover, long-term investors and analysts view Palantir shares as worth owning, especially on dips, cautioning that the stock is more suited to long-term holding than short-term trading. The company’s ongoing contracts and market foothold may help limit downside risk, creating potential losses for shorts if the stock maintains or gains upward momentum.

### Conclusion
Short-selling Palantir Technologies is a high-risk, potentially high-reward strategy. The firm’s high valuation and dilution risks support the case for shorting, especially in the event of market volatility or a negative earnings surprise. However, Palantir’s robust growth prospects, strategic market position, and bullish momentum mean that the stock might resist downside pressures, potentially causing losses for short sellers if the company continues to deliver strong results and investor confidence remains high. Investors considering short positions should be prepared for significant volatility and maintain strict risk controls given Palantir's compelling long-term story despite its lofty multiples.
